2002 Camaro B4C Special Service Coupe. 

Only 14,000 miles on this beautiful Camaro.  Stored winters and never driven in bad weather.

This is a rare Camaro!  I have been able to determine it is equipped as only one of six B4Cs and very well may be a one of one Camaro.  It came factory equipped with the rare (for cop cars) six speed manual transmission, a factory installed short throw Hurst Shifter and factory installed chrome wheels.

Only 18 red, manual transmission cars were built in 2002 out of the 708 total B4C cars that were assembled.  I have been able to track down 12 of the 18 built and none are equipped like this one.

This B4C Camaro was originally part of a fleet order for a major university, but never went into law enforcement service.  It was first sold to a Camaro collector who owned the car from 2002 to 2007.  In that time period, he only put 400 miles on the vehicle.

Known by the Chevrolet Option Code B4C, the Special Service Coupes were built at the Camaro plant in Quebec and are Z-28's without any badges.  There are a few minor differences from a stock Z-28.  There is quite a bit of documentation for the vehicle including the original window sticker, service records, delivery records from GM and confirmation records on it's potential one of one status.  Email for additional pictures and info, contact tlaughlin2@aol.com

2002 Camaro Special    Service Coupe.

Formally a Florida Highway Patrol "marked"  unit, the car was  assigned to Florida Highway Patrol Troop L in Palm Beach, FL until July 05. 

Known by the Chevrolet Option Code B4C, this is one of 200 - 2002 Camaros ordered by the State of Florida.  The B4C Special Service Coupes were built at the Camaro plant in Quebec and are Z-28's without any badges.  There are a few minor differences from a stock Z-28.

This is one of the 708 B4C Camaros built in 2002, the last year of Camaro production.  It is 1 of 320 black B4C's with auto trans.

I have a lot of documentation, including the build sheet on the vehicle, a copy of the title to the FHP and a print out of delivery information and other details from GM. We have made contact with the Florida Highway Patrol and they were nice enough to give us the service records and a picture of the Trooper that drove the car during its 3 years of service.
